This hotel is nowhere near an 8.2. The Hyatt Regency is 8.4 and this is nowhere near that quality. The hotel is built from modular single wides and is old and tired. The reviews must be seeded from hotel management. The first clue is that it is not a 8.2 is that you have to pay each day to use the internet. The rooms are 12 ft x 12 ft with no windows. The doors have glass slats in them but the built in blinds would not open so the room was dark. There are no chairs so when you are in the room you have to lay on the bed. The floor is soft and spongy. It has vinyl planks but some of them were cracked. The bathroom floor had sections missing. There was no water pressure and the shower dripped out even though the shower head looked very nice. The toilet was cheap and had water running down the sides as it was not insulated. Someone put effort into painting and decorating the room but the mold along the doors and shower door took away from this effort We had supper in the restaurant and it was very good The location is heavy industrial but we felt safe there The road to the hotel is confusing as at one point you seem to come to a dead end but you continue through a lane over the railroad track. If you then see a mound of garbage on the side of the road you are on the right route. 25 minutes to the airport 15 minutes to the French Quarter Hotel shuttle to the French Quarter is $20 return per person and it runs from 10 until 4. I suggest that you take an Uber for $22 each
